Cognitive filtering of content from shared screen display

Inventors: Thangadurai Muthusamy (Bangalore, IN); Chourasia Abhishek Kumar (Bangalore, IN); Saravanan Devendran (Bangalore, IN); Pietro Iannucci (Rome, IT)
Assignee: Kyndryl, Inc.

Abstract

Methods, computer program products, and/or systems are provided that perform the following operations: obtaining source display content; identifying one or more objectionable portions included in the source display content; modifying the one or more objectionable portions included in the source display content to filter content in the one or more objectionable portions; generating a filtered display content, wherein the filtered display content includes the one or more modified objectionable portions and one or more non-objectionable portions of the source display content; and providing the filtered display content for rendering of a shared presentation.

Claims (78)

1. A computer-implemented method comprising:

obtaining source display content, the source display content including shared screen content rendered by and being displayed on a screen of a source device and being output by the source device for concurrent display thereof by a remote device located remotely from the source device;

identifying one or more objectionable portions included in the source display content;

modifying the one or more objectionable portions included in the source display content to filter content in the one or more objectionable portions;

generating a filtered display content, wherein the filtered display content includes the one or more modified objectionable portions and one or more non-objectionable portions of the source display content; and

providing the filtered display content for rendering of filtered shared screen content by the remote device while the shared screen content is being displayed on the screen of the source device in original form.

2. The computer-implemented method of claim 1 , wherein identifying the one or more objectionable portions included in the source display content comprises:

obtaining text data and image data in the source display content; and

classifying some portions of the source display content as potential objectionable content and classifying other portions of the source display content as potential non-objectionable content based, at least in part, on the text data and image data.

3. The computer-implemented method of claim 2 , further comprising:

providing the text data and the image data to an image classifier model, wherein the image classifier model is trained to classify the source display content as objectionable content, as non-objectional content, or some of the content as objectionable content and some of the content as non-objectionable content;

identifying portions of the source display content as objectionable; and

providing the identified portions of the source display content to an image reconstruction model, wherein the image reconstruction model is trained to filter the one or more objectionable portions to obscure content and generate the filtered display content.

4. The computer-implemented method of claim 3 , further comprising:

providing one or more of the objectionable portions to the image reconstruction model;

filtering the one or more objectionable portions to generate one or more modified objectionable portions including obscured content;

providing the one or more non-objectionable portions to the image reconstruction model; and

generating the filtered display content based on the one or more non-objectionable portions and the one or more modified objectionable portions.

5. The computer-implemented method of claim 4 , further comprising:

providing preview filtered display content based on the filtered display content;

obtaining indications that one or more portions of the preview filtered display content were misclassified; and

providing data associated with the one or more misclassified portions for use in updating the image classifier model.

6. The computer-implemented method of claim 1 , wherein modifying the one or more objectionable portions included in the source display content comprises:

masking the one or more objectionable portions to generate the one or more modified objectionable portions, wherein the masking obscures content in the one or more objectionable portions.

7. The computer-implemented method of claim 1 , further comprising:

obtaining feedback data associated with the filtered display content, the feedback data including one or more indications of objectionable content misclassified as non-objectionable; and

updating an image classifier model and an image reconstruction model based, at least in part, on the feedback data.

8. The computer-implemented method of claim 7 , wherein the feedback data includes user preference data.

9. The computer-implemented method of claim 7 , wherein the feedback data includes historical shared screen content interaction data associated with the filtered display content.

10. The computer-implemented method of claim 1 , wherein the shared screen content rendered by and displayed on the screen of the source device includes a presentation controlled by a user at the source device during a video conference.
